Step 1: Quick Assessment and Water Extraction
Our technicians will assess the situation and extract the water using our high-capacity pumps.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th. We’ll use our truck-mounted extractors to handle large amounts of water efficiently.
Step 2: Water Removal and Drying Equipment Deployment
Next, we’ll deploy our specialized equipment, including dehumidifiers and air movers, to speed up the drying process. This will help prevent secondary damage and promote a safe environment for you and your loved ones.
Step 3: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We’ll apply our proprietary sanitizing agents to remove any bacteria, viruses, or other microorganisms that may have been present due to the water damage. This step is vital in preventing the spread of germs and keeping your living space healthy.
Step 4: Final Touches and Quality Control
Once the area is completely dry,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ure everything meets our high standards. This includes verifying that the space is free from any remaining moisture, odors, or signs of water damage.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ors in your living room could be a sign of hidden water damage or mold growth. Don’t ignore these warning signs, they can spread quickly and cause serious health issues. Our team will help you identify and remove the source of the odor.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Visible water stains or discoloration on your walls or ceiling can be a sign of hidden water damage. These stains can spread and cause costly repairs if left untreated. Our team will assess the situation and provide a solution to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ring is a clear indication of water damage. If left untreated, this can lead to costly repairs and compromise the structural integrity of your home. Our team will help you repair or replace your flooring to prevent further damage.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or moisture buildup in your living room. This can lead to costly repairs and create an unhealthy environment for you and your family. Our team will help you identify and address the issue quickly.
Unpleasant Smells or Bacterial Growth
Unpleasant smells or visible bacterial growth in your living room can be a sign of water damage or poor ventilation. Don’t ignore these warning signs, they can spread quickly and cause serious health issues. Our team will help you identify and remove the source of the problem.
Living Room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small, isolated water spill (less than 1 sq. Ft.) | Yes, DIY is fine. | No need to call a pro. | Easy to contain and clean up quickly. |
| Visible water damage or warping on your floor | No, don’t try to fix it yourself. | Call a pro to prevent further damage. | Hidden water damage can cause costly repairs and compromise the structural integrity of your home. |
| Musty odors or visible mold growth | No, don’t ignore the issue. | Call a pro to remove the source of the problem. | Ignoring these signs can lead to serious health issues and costly repairs. |
| Large-scale water damage or flooding | No, don’t try to tackle it alone. | Call a pro to mitigate the damage and prevent further complications. | Large-scale water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and ensure a safe environment. |

Living Room Water Removal Cost In Priest River, ID
The cost of living room water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Priest River, ID. These estimates may vary based on the specifics of your situation. We’ll provide a free on-site assessment to find out the best course of action and provide a more accurate estimate.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ction and Removal |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and amount of water extracted |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$300 – $1,500 | Size of affected area and number of dehumidifiers used |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| Severity of bacterial or mold growth |
| Final Inspection and Quality Control | $100 – $500 | Complexity of the job and number of inspections required |
